JOB SUMMARY

The Helpdesk Analyst will serve as first point of contact to end users, delivering exceptional technical support, and ensuring positive experience. The Helpdesk Analyst will be responsible for troubleshooting including break/fix support, assisting network administrators and applications personnel. Key responsibilities will include documentation, tracking, and follow-up on all help desk calls as well as assisting the network administrators with all hardware and infrastructure deployments.

This role is located in Des Plaines, Illinois.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

End User Support and Customer Service

  • Serve as point of contact with help desk tickets and requests (via phone calls and/or emails) for employees seeking technical assistance
  • Effectively and accurately document incidents, requests, and resolutions within ticketing system
  • Ensure requests for technology services and support are properly recorded, assessed, prioritized, addressed timely and properly escalated.
  • Build strong internal customer relationships by addressing issues with the proper level of urgency.
  • Develop a trusting relationship with the application development and network administration personnel by becoming the first line of support for business applications and infrastructure tools.

Technical Troubleshooting and Resolution

  • Configure, install, troubleshoot, and repair PC and hardware.
  • Troubleshoot Microsoft 365 and other business applications.
  • Utilize remote tools and resources to solve issues effectively and efficiently.
  • Contribute to internal knowledge to improve service delivery and efficacy.

IT Operations and Infrastructure Support

  • Contribute to the design of network architecture, integration and installation.
  • Work closely with network administrations to maintain software/LAN/WAN/wireless security and integrity.
  • Provide ad hoc report writing support and training for other departments.
  • Other duties as assigned.

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
